MTD Cub Cadet 221 HP Snow Blower Manual
The MTD Cub Cadet 221 HP Snow Blower is a powerful and efficient machine designed to tackle heavy snowfall with ease. It features a 221cc engine, a 24-inch clearing width, and a 21-inch intake height, making it suitable for residential use. This manual provides essential information on safety, operation, maintenance, and troubleshooting to ensure optimal performance.
Features at a Glance
The MTD Cub Cadet 221 HP Snow Blower includes several key features:
- Powerful Engine: 221cc engine provides reliable performance in heavy snow.
- Clearing Width: 24 inches allows for efficient snow removal.
- Adjustable Chute: 180-degree rotation for directing snow where needed.
- Ergonomic Controls: Easy-to-use controls for comfortable operation.
- Headlight: Illuminates the path for nighttime use.

Troubleshooting
| Symptom | Possible Cause | Corrective Action |
| Engine won't start | Fuel issue | Check fuel level and quality; ensure choke is set correctly. |
| Snow blower not clearing | Clogged chute | Turn off the engine and clear any blockages. |
| Uneven snow throwing | Improper speed setting | Adjust speed and throttle settings accordingly. |
